Day One - Hike 22km along the Skyline Trail, from Jasper town to Curator campsite up on the Maligne mountain range. Total elevation gain of 820m, to a maximum elevation of 2510m (8,200ft).
Day Two - Hike 22km along the remainder of the Skyline Trail to Maligne Lake. From there, pick up mountain bike and cycle 40km down the mountain lake road to Maligne Canyon Hostel.
Day Three - Cycle 20km up the Athabasca river trail to the start point for rafting and kayaking. Take a raft or kayak (tbc) 20km down the river back to Jasper town. Finally, cycle home to bed!
